Hogyan találhatom meg a PID-t és a PPID-t Linuxon?

Hol található a PID és a PPID a Linuxban?

Szülő PID (PPID) beszerzése a gyermek folyamatazonosítójából (PID) a parancssor használatával. pl. ps -o ppid= 2072 2061-et ad vissza , amelyet könnyen használhatsz szkriptben stb. ps -o ppid= -C foo a foo paranccsal adja meg a folyamat PPID-jét. Használhatja a régimódi ps | grep : ps -eo ppid,comm | grep '[f]oo' .

Hogyan találhatom meg a PID-t Linuxban?

Hogyan kaphatom meg az adott folyamat pid számát egy Linux operációs rendszeren, bash shell használatával? A legegyszerűbb módja annak, hogy megtudja, fut-e a folyamat futtassa a ps aux parancsot és a grep folyamat nevét. Ha a kimenetet a folyamatnévvel/pid-vel együtt kapta meg, akkor a folyamat fut.

Mi az a PID és PPID Linuxban?

A PID a Process ID rövidítése, Ami a memóriában jelenleg futó folyamat azonosító számát jelenti. 2. A PPID a Parent Process ID rövidítése, ami azt jelenti, hogy a szülői folyamat felelős az aktuális folyamat (gyermekfolyamat) létrehozásáért.

Mi a különbség a PID és a PPID között?

A folyamatazonosító (PID) egy egyedi azonosító, amely a folyamathoz van rendelve annak futása közben. … Az új folyamatot létrehozó folyamatot szülő folyamatnak nevezzük; az új folyamatot gyermekfolyamatnak nevezzük. A szülőfolyamat-azonosító (PPID) az új utódfolyamathoz lesz társítva annak létrehozásakor. A PPID-t nem használják jobvezérlésre.

Hogyan szerezhetem be a PID bash-t?

Könnyen megtalálhatja az utoljára végrehajtott parancs PID-jét a shell scriptben vagy a bash-ban. Ez az oldal elmagyarázza, hogyan kaphatja meg az utoljára végrehajtott alkalmazás/program PID-jét.
...
A szintaxis a következő:

  1. Nyissa meg a terminál alkalmazást.
  2. Futtassa a parancsot vagy alkalmazást a háttérben. …
  3. Az utoljára végrehajtott parancstípus PID-jének lekéréséhez: echo „$!”

Hogyan találhatom meg a PID folyamat nevét?

A 9999 folyamatazonosító parancssorának lekéréséhez olvassa el a /proc/9999/cmdline fájlt. A 9999 folyamatazonosítóhoz tartozó folyamatnév megszerzéséhez olvassa el a fájl /proc/9999/comm .

Hogyan találhatom meg a PID folyamatát?

A PID beszerzése a Feladatkezelővel

  1. Nyomja meg a Ctrl+Shift+Esc billentyűkombinációt a billentyűzeten.
  2. Lépjen a Folyamatok lapra.
  3. Kattintson a jobb gombbal a táblázat fejlécére, és válassza a helyi menü PID menüpontját.

Mi az a PID parancs a Linuxban?

Mi az a PID a Linuxban? A PID az a folyamatazonosító szám rövidítése. A PID automatikusan hozzárendelődik minden egyes folyamathoz, amikor azokat Linux operációs rendszeren hozzák létre. … Az init vagy systemd mindig az első folyamat a Linux operációs rendszeren, és az összes többi folyamat szülője.

Mi az a PID és SID?

PID – Folyamatazonosító. PPID – Szülő folyamatazonosító. SID – Session ID. PGID – Process Group ID. UID – Felhasználói azonosító.

Mi a szülő PID-je?

Amikor egy folyamat egy másik folyamatot hoz létre, az új folyamat lesz a folyamat leszármazottja, amelyet szülőjének nevezünk. … Ha a szülői folyamat kilép, és a gyermek még mindig fut, a gyermeket az init folyamat, az első folyamat és mindenki végső szülője örökli.

Mi az init folyamat PID-je?

Az 1. folyamatazonosító általában az init folyamat elsősorban a rendszer indításáért és leállításáért felelős. … Az újabb Unix rendszereken jellemzően további kernelkomponensek láthatók „folyamatokként”, ebben az esetben a PID 1 aktívan le van foglalva az init folyamat számára, hogy fenntartsa a konzisztenciát a régebbi rendszerekkel.

Tetszik ez a bejegyzés? Kérjük, ossza meg barátaival:
OS ma